The term of the lease refers to its duration, or how long the rental agreement will survive. Typical residential leases have a duration of one year, though they can be less or more. Commercial and agricultural leases are usually for one year or more. Generally in most states, if the term of the lease agreement exceeds one year it must be in writing.

The names of the parties, needless to say, are famed. It is going to be tough to enforce a lease that does not correctly identify the parties involved. You don't have to contain tax identification numbers or Social Security numbers, but you should have the first and last names or the name of the company involved. Include the contact information of the parties too.

Establish the amount of rent in the lease agreement. Additionally, the parties should include when the rent is due and how often. The rent for residential leases is usually due on the first day of every month. Agricultural and commercial leases may require rent to be paid twice annually or annually.

State the purpose of the lease in the lease deal. This may also affect the application of specific laws to the rental agreement and will restrict a tenant's ability to use the premises for other uses. Many states have different laws for different types of leases. For instance, a warranty of habitability, meaning the landlord must maintain the premises in a habitable condition, is employed only to residential leases in many states.

Sublets are another kind of short term leases. In a sublet, his property will be rented out by a renter to another person for a brief period of time. If the tenant has a lease on the property, they are going to remain the leading leaseholder and will either sign a separate contract with the short term renter or add the person as a sublet on to their present lease.
